Storm types

Six severe weather types. One radar engine.

Each event type is verified against the right radar product — hail, wind, tornado, flood, winter, hurricane. You pick the address; we pick the method.

MESH

Hail

Maximum Estimated Size of Hail per radar sweep, intersected with parcel polygon.

Threshold > 1.0"

GUST

Wind

Peak gust velocity from radial Doppler velocity at the lowest tilt angle.

Threshold > 58 mph

TVS

Tornado

Tornadic Vortex Signature plus NWS confirmed track polygons.

Any EF rating

QPE

Flood

Quantitative Precipitation Estimate over rolling windows + FEMA flood zone overlap.

Threshold > 2"/hr

SWE

Winter

Snow Water Equivalent + ice accumulation from dual-pol radar correlation.

Threshold > 6" snow / 0.25" ice

NHC

Hurricane

National Hurricane Center cone + best-track wind swath at parcel coordinates.

Cat 1 and above

Where does the weather data come from?

NOAA NEXRAD Level II radar — the same primary feed the National Weather Service uses — plus NWS storm reports, ASOS surface stations, USGS stream gauges, and NHC hurricane track data. Every figure in a report cites its source inline.

How accurate is the confidence score?

Scored against NEXRAD radar signatures and SPC storm reports. High (≥85%) means the radar evidence is strong and cross-referenced with a ground-truth report. Medium is 65–84%, Low is below 65%. "None detected" is a valid and defensible result — we never inflate confidence to make a report look better.

Can BeyondClaim make up results?

No. Every figure — hail size, gust speed, event date — is tied to a specific NEXRAD sweep ID and parcel polygon. If radar doesn’t support a result, the report says so. The system cannot invent a data point.
